PENSACOLA, Fla. -- Congressman Jimmy Patronis has announced a series of initiatives aimed at fostering the growth of small businesses in Northwest Florida. During a recent discussion, Patronis emphasized the vital role that small enterprises play in the local economy, highlighting their contributions to job creation and community development.
Patronis outlined several strategies designed to enhance support for entrepreneurs and small business owners. These include increasing access to funding, streamlining regulatory processes, and promoting local business initiatives. The congressman believes that by providing these resources, small businesses will have a better chance to innovate and expand, ultimately benefiting the entire region.
In addition to financial support, Patronis stressed the importance of community engagement and collaboration among local stakeholders. He encouraged partnerships between businesses, educational institutions, and government agencies to create a robust ecosystem that nurtures entrepreneurship. With these plans in place, Patronis aims to ensure that Northwest Florida remains a vibrant hub for small business growth and economic prosperity.
